Senior US Republican Senator John Cornyn has formally congratulated Prime Minister Narendra Modi on becoming India's longest-serving continuously elected head of government. Highlighting that the US-India partnership has never been stronger, the commendation underscores deep economic alignment and progressing trade negotiations between the Trump administration and New Delhi.
WASHINGTON DC — A prominent member of President Donald Trump’s Republican Party has formally extended diplomatic congratulations to Indian Prime Minister Narendra Modi following his historic domestic milestone. On June 10, 2026, United States Senator John Cornyn, a high-ranking Republican representing Texas and the co-chair of the Senate India Caucus, issued a comprehensive statement applauding Modi for officially becoming India's longest continuously serving democratically elected Prime Minister.
This development carries considerable diplomatic importance today as the United States and India actively navigate intense bilateral trade discussions following a period of complex tariff negotiations. The public alignment from a key legislative ally of the Trump administration signals a concerted effort to project absolute continuity, structural stability, and unprecedented strategic strength in the Indo-Pacific region.
Bipartisan Praise for a Transformational Milestone
The diplomatic communication arrived immediately after administrative registries in New Delhi confirmed that Prime Minister Modi had completed 4,399 consecutive days in office, surpassing the long-held elected continuity record of India's first Prime Minister, Jawaharlal Nehru.
In an official public brief, Senator Cornyn emphasized that Modi’s unbroken twelve-year administrative timeline reflects a historic democratic mandate. He pointed out that the Prime Minister's leadership across three successive democratic cycles has been anchored firmly in the explicit trust of 1.4 billion citizens.
The Republican senator specifically highlighted India’s macroeconomic evolution over the past decade, attributing the country's status as the world’s fastest-growing major economy to the administration's localized financial policies. Cornyn noted that state-led development initiatives had successfully lifted approximately 250 million individuals out of systemic poverty, describing the domestic transformation as a critical foundation for enhanced international cooperation.
Trade Realignment and Geopolitical Implications
The high-level congratulatory message arrives at a vital juncture for international businesses, corporate investors, and cross-border trade organizations. Bilateral dynamics have faced noticeable pressures after the implementation of specific reciprocal import tariffs over the past fiscal year. However, recent diplomatic actions indicate a rapid turnaround in executive relations.
Bilateral Trade Advancements: United States Trade Representative (USTR) officials recently concluded a foundational four-day legislative visit to New Delhi from June 1–4, 2026. Official summaries indicate major progress on market access protocols, automated customs procedures, and collaborative trade facilitation measures.
The Tariff Resolution: The diplomatic momentum is strongly supported by President Donald Trump, who recently stated that both sovereign nations are nearing a comprehensive, mutually beneficial trade agreement, explicitly citing his close personal rapport with Prime Minister Modi.
Investor Confidence: For global markets and institutional investors, the direct public endorsement by a senior US lawmaker provides strong assurances of policy predictability, solidifying supply-chain diversification and joint technological development under the U.S.-India COMPACT framework.

What is the Senate India Caucus mentioned in the official reports?
The Senate India Caucus is a formal, bipartisan coalition of United States Senators dedicated to promoting structural dialogue, economic trade, security cooperation, and stronger diplomatic relations between the United States and India.
